Rear Roller
Three types of rear rollers have been used on the
Groundsmaster 3500--D. One roller design has sealed
bearings with no grease fittings on the r oller shaft. The
second design has grease fittings in the roller shaft
ends. The third design has grease fittings incorporated
into the roller fasteners. Removal and installation of the
rear roller from the cutting deck is the same, regardless
of roller type.
Removal (Fig. 13)
1. Park machine on a level surface, lower cutting units,
stop engine, engage parking brake, and remove key
from the ignition switch.
2. If cutting deck is equipped with roller scraper, re-
move roller scraper from deck.
A. If equipped with early style roller scraper (Fig.
14), loosen one locknut that secures roller scraper
rod to mounting bracket.
B. Remove fasteners securing left and right scraper
rod brackets to roller mounts (Figs. 14 and 15).
C. Remove scraper rod assembly from cutting deck.
3. Remove four (4) mounting screws securing roller
mounts to rear of deck frame. Remove roller mounts and
rear roller assembly from deck frame.
4. Loosen fasteners securing each end of roller to roller
mounts. Remove mounts from roller.
Installation (Fig. 13)
1. Place roller assembly into roller mounts.
2. Install roller and roller mount assembly into rear of
deck frame. Secure assembly to deck frame with flange
head screws.
IMPORTANT: If roller design includes grease fittings in
roller fasteners ( items 8 and 9 in Fig. 13), make sure the
grease groove in each roller mount aligns with the
grease hole in each end of the roller shaft. To help align
the groove and hole, there is also an alignment mark on
one end of the roller shaft.
3. Tighten fasteners that secure each end of roller to
roller mounts.
4. If equipped, install scraper rod assembly to roller
mounts. Adjust scraper rod (see Adjust Roller Scraper
in the Adjustments section).
5. If roller design allows greasing, lubricate roller
grease points.
